About plastic tighteners

Types of plastic tighteners

A plastic tightener is a small device that helps secure and adjust the length of a drawstring or cord. It's often used in items like hoodies, sweatpants, bags, and tents. There are different types of plastic tighteners, which are described below:

  • Single Hole Toggles:

    Single hole toggles are the simplest kind of plastic tightener. They have one hole that the drawstring goes through. The toggle can be pulled along the string to adjust the length. These are commonly used on sweatpants and hoods.

  • Double Hole Toggles:

    Double-hole toggles have two holes, one on each side. The drawstring goes through both holes. They provide a tighter grip than single-hole toggles since the string is secured in two places. These are often used on jackets with two drawstrings.

  • Spring-Loaded Cord Locks:

    Spring-loaded cord locks have a spring inside that pushes a small lever down over the drawstring. To tighten, users squeeze the sides of the lock, releasing the string so it can be pulled tighter. When the squeeze stops, the spring pushes the lever to grip the string again. This allows easy adjustment without the tightener sliding by itself. These are often used on backpacks that have drawstrings to close the top.

  • Slider Locks:

    Slider locks are plastic tighteners that slide up and down the drawstring. They have a flat shape and grip the string in the same way as spring-loaded locks. To adjust the length, users simply slide the lock with the hand. Slider locks provide a more low-profile look than other types and are often used on outdoor gear like tents.

  • Specialty Toggles:

    Some plastic tighteners have special designs to grip the drawstring in certain ways. For example, a gear toggle has small gears inside that catch the string when pulled but allow upward sliding. These are used on items like helmets where the fit needs to be adjusted tightly but can slide for removal.

How to choose plastic tighteners

When selecting suitable plastic cable tighteners, there are many options to consider. Below are some of the crucial factors that buyers need to consider.

  • Type of Application

    There are different types of applications for plastic cable tighteners. For instance, in marine applications, the plastic cable clamps are designed to withstand harsh environments. They have corrosion-resistant features. At the same time, the plastic used in automotive applications can resist high temperatures and chemicals. On the other hand, general-purpose plastic tighteners are suitable for household or industrial applications.

  • Load Requirements

    It is vital to consider the amount of load or weight the cables will bear. Heavy-duty plastic cable tighteners are suitable for high-load applications. They have enhanced strength and durability. These cable tighteners have reinforced structures and use high-quality industrial-grade plastic. For less demanding applications, regular plastic tighteners are adequate. They are suitable for general use in the home or light-duty industrial applications.

  • Environmental Conditions

    The environmental conditions where the cables are located can also affect their performance. For example, plastic cable clamps in outdoor areas are exposed to sunlight, rain, or snow. They need UV-stabilized plastic to prevent them from degrading due to the sun's powerful rays. At the same time, these plastic tighteners have moisture-proof features to keep water out and avoid rusting. In marine applications, the plastic tighteners are submerged in water. They have anti-corrosive features for easy drainage. These features prevent the accumulation of water, which can cause rusting.

  • Temperature Range

    The temperature range in a particular location can influence the choice of plastic tighteners. Areas with extreme heat need tighteners that can withstand high temperatures. The tighteners will not become deformed or brittle. In places with cold temperatures, the plastic tighteners will remain flexible. They will not break or snap in the cold weather.

  • Installation and Maintenance

    Consider the ease of installation and maintenance requirements. Look for plastic tighteners that are easy to install. They will help the user or technician save time when installing the cables. At the same time, these plastic tighteners require no special tools for installation. This makes them ideal for DIY enthusiasts. Also, the plastic tighteners should have features that make it easy to adjust or remove them in case of maintenance.
